From Idea to Market: A Complete MVP Development Strategy

From Idea to Market: A Complete MVP Development Strategy

In today’s fast-paced digital era, businesses must be agile and efficient when bringing new products to market. This is where MVP Development Services come into play. A Minimum Viable Product (MVP) allows companies to test their product idea with minimal resources while maximizing insights. In this blog, we’ll explore a comprehensive strategy for MVP development, emphasizing its importance in building successful products.

What Is an MVP?

A Minimum Viable Product is a simplified version of a product that includes only its core features. It is designed to gather maximum validated learning about users with the least effort. The primary objective is to test assumptions, gather user feedback, and make data-driven decisions.

Why MVP Development Services Are Crucial

  1. Cost-Efficiency: MVPs reduce development costs by focusing only on essential features.
  2. Faster Time-to-Market: Launching an MVP allows businesses to enter the market quickly, gaining a competitive edge.
  3. Risk Mitigation: By validating the product idea early, companies can minimize the risk of building a product no one wants.
  4. User-Centric Development: Continuous feedback ensures the product aligns with user expectations.

A Step-by-Step MVP Development Strategy

1. Ideation and Problem Definition

Every successful MVP begins with a clear understanding of the problem you want to solve.

  • Identify the Core Problem: What issue does your product address?
  • Define Your Target Audience: Understand your users’ pain points, behaviors, and preferences.

2. Market Research and Competitive Analysis

Before diving into development, conduct thorough research:

  • Analyze competitors to identify gaps in the market.
  • Validate your idea by gathering insights from potential users through surveys, interviews, or focus groups.

3. Define Core Features

The essence of an MVP is simplicity. Focus on features that directly solve the problem.

  • Create a feature prioritization matrix.
  • Use frameworks like MoSCoW (Must-Have, Should-Have, Could-Have, Won’t-Have) to rank features.

4. Create a Development Roadmap

An MVP development roadmap ensures clarity and aligns your team.

  • Break down the project into manageable sprints.
  • Assign clear roles and responsibilities to team members.

Partnering with MVP Development Services

Working with experienced MVP development teams can streamline the process:

  • Expertise: Professionals bring technical and market knowledge to the table.
  • Efficiency: They use proven methodologies like Agile to accelerate development.
  • Scalability: A well-designed MVP lays the foundation for future product iterations.

5. Build the MVP

Technology Selection

Choose technologies that are scalable and cost-effective. For example:

  • Frontend: React.js, Vue.js
  • Backend: Node.js, Python
  • Mobile: Flutter, React Native

Development Process

Adopt an Agile methodology to iterate rapidly and incorporate user feedback effectively.

6. Testing and Quality Assurance

Testing is a crucial step in MVP development to ensure functionality and user satisfaction.

  • Usability Testing: Ensure the interface is intuitive.
  • Functionality Testing: Verify that core features work as intended.
  • Performance Testing: Confirm the product can handle user load.

7. Launch and Gather Feedback

Once your MVP is built, launch it to your target audience.

  • Use analytics tools to track user behavior.
  • Collect qualitative feedback through surveys or interviews.
  • Identify patterns and areas for improvement.

8. Iterate and Improve

Post-launch feedback is the backbone of your MVP development strategy.

  • Address pain points raised by users.
  • Gradually introduce new features based on demand.
  • Test each update to ensure quality and user satisfaction.

Key Components of a Successful MVP Development Strategy

1. Customer-Centric Approach

Always prioritize user needs and preferences throughout the development cycle.

2. Data-Driven Decisions

Rely on metrics and feedback to refine the product.

3. Scalability

Ensure your MVP is built on a scalable architecture to accommodate future growth.

4. Time Management

Set realistic deadlines to maintain momentum and meet market demands.

Real-Life Examples of MVP Success

1. Dropbox

Dropbox started as a simple explainer video demonstrating its concept. This MVP validated demand before a single line of code was written.

2. Airbnb

Airbnb’s initial website targeted small markets, proving the viability of the home-sharing model before scaling globally.

3. Twitter

Originally an internal tool for employees, Twitter’s MVP helped test the concept before becoming a global phenomenon.

Conclusion

MVP Development Services empower businesses to turn ideas into reality with minimal risk and maximum efficiency. By adopting a customer-focused and iterative approach, you can validate your product idea, adapt to user needs, and achieve sustainable growth. Whether you’re a startup testing a new concept or an enterprise exploring innovative solutions, a robust MVP development strategy is your pathway to success.

Partner with experts in MVP Development Services to bring your vision to life while ensuring scalability, flexibility, and long-term success.

要查看或添加评论,请登录

Reckonsys Tech Labs的更多文章

社区洞察

其他会员也浏览了